DV01 Dashboard

Designed the DV01 Dashboard for the Finastra Kondor 3.5 treasury platform. The dashboard enables Forex professionals to measure the interest rate sensitivities and visualizations for currency positions and pairs.
Addition of Forex risk assessment capabilities
Used by over 8K institutons
Tools to measure delta values in reporting currency

Context
Financial institutions like banks have to juggle regulatory complexity while managing risk in real-time across volatile markets. Finastra's Kondor 3.5 is a treasury platform that transforms fragmented trading and risk systems into unified tools with real-time analytics, dynamic dashboards, and seamless integration. It delivers the speed, accuracy, and compliance that modern financial regulations demand.
Challenge
Financial institutions struggle with interest rate risk because they use different systems that give conflicting numbers for DV01 calculations, are unable to see a holistic view with rate exposures in one place or in the same currency, and lack the fast analysis tools needed to protect against losses when interest rates change quickly across their trading portfolios.
Business Goals
Generate revenue from financial institutions needing enterprise licensing for comprehensive forex risk assessment tools. The value added features would support Finastra's goal of increasing treasury transactions by 10x.
User Goals
Institutional users can get a holistic snapshot of their interest rate exposures in one clear view with consistent currency reporting. They are enabled to make quick hedging decisions when markets move in order to improve returns, and get comprehensive reports that help them manage the company's overall interest rate risk.

Comprehensive Risk Assessment Tools

Contextual menus
Grid views showcase interest rate variability of currency pairs for predefined time ranges called 'Tenors'.
Contextual menus for 'Trade contribution' and 'Open trades'.
Trade contribution refers to the individual P&L impact that each specific trade has on a portfolio's overall performance.
Open trades are active positions that have not yet been closed or settled.

Attributes and Buckets
Tools to create custom attributes and buckets.
Attributes are properties used to classify, categorize, and manage financial instruments, trades and positions.
Bucket lists group investments, risks, or exposures into categories based on shared characteristics, risk levels, or time horizons.

Manage Tenors
In the DV01 application, tenors are time periods that help organize interest rate risk calculations for institutions.
Users can create new tenors, modify or delete existing ones.
This helps users to organize interest rate risk by time periods based on their specific needs.

Manage Buckets
Buckets are containers that group your interest rate positions based on specific tenors.
Users are allowed to connect existing tenors to buckets.
The user is also allowed to toggle between native and reporting currency pairs and modify them.

Gathering Insights on Current Workflows
Activities
Workflow analysis
Personas
Requirements gathering

Discovery and requirements gathering
Workflow analysis
Research revealed that Forex traders waste 30-45 minutes daily calculating DV01 risk manually in Excel because current systems are too slow and don't integrate with their trading platforms. There was a need for real time DV01 calculations (under 1 second) that automatically aggregate hundreds of Forex positions across currency pairs and tenors, with seamless integration to existing trading systems.
"Risk sensitivities should be accessed globally by using the dashboard. It gives our users a comprehensive look at risk and its impact on FX portfolios."
-Vincent Prado (Finastra Product team)
Personas
Forex Traders
They use use DV01 to see, in real time, how interest changes impact their currency positions. They rely on fast dashboards and custom curve views to track exposure across multiple currencies. Their priority is speed and clarity.
Risk Officers
They look at the big picture. They focus on the firm’s overall exposure to rate changes. They use DV01 to aggregate deltas, run shock scenarios, and set alerts on risky thresholds. Their priority is about governance and reporting.
Credit Risk Officers
They care about the macro effects of how rates affect credit portfolios. They use DV01 to see sensitivity by rating or sector and to run stress tests that combine rate moves with credit shocks. Their priority is insights that link deltas to real credit impacts.
Requirements
DV01 table.
Toggles for Currency: Native vs Reference.
Toggles for Type: Curve View vs Trade View.
Trade Contribution List table: Deal Type, Instrument Type, Notional, Maturity, Counterparty.
Interactive curve charts for LIBOR and Federal Funds curves.
Comparative view for curves.
Tiered access for Traders, Risk Officers and Credit Officers.
Compliance with audit and governance requirements.

Key Insights
Context is key
Risk assessments are done always in context to currency pairs, curve types and trade-level impact.
Speed and trust
DV01 must prioritize real-time updates, transparent calculation logic and data visualization.
Role based customizations
Tailored dashboards, permissions, and workflows to ensure role based access and entitlements.

User flow diagram showcasing overall UX for the DV01 dashboard
User flows
Cross-functional collaboration with Product, Business and Engineering to align on key user flows by use cases and personas.
User opens DV01 dashboard through the Kondor navigation launcher.
User views the DV01 table grid with the ability to set currency pairs and tenors.
User can choose to drill down to a specific item through trade contribution list.
User can view LIBOR or Federal Fund curves.
Wireframes
Rapid , iterative wireframes were created in Figma to showcase the layouts and demonstrate key features and flows.

Early layout concept for DV01 dashboard

Approved final design
High-fidelity design
Approved designs were crafted into high-fidelity screens using customized Finastra design system. The design system was aligned with Finastra brand guidelines and would be consistent across the Kondor 3.5 platform.
Prototypes
End-to-end experiences presented to Product, Engineering and Business stakeholders for alignment and approvals before development work began.

End-to-end experience prototype

Presentations shared with stakeholders
Presentations
Platform-level consistency and reusability were core priorities for Kondor 3.5 platform. To support this, monthly meetings were held with business stakeholders to align on parallel product initiatives and ensure everyone was working toward a shared product vision.
